The Barn, Milton

The Barn is a barn conversion on the owner's working farm in the hamlet of Milton near Brampton in Cumbria. The property sleeps six people in three bedrooms, comprising of a super king-size double with an en-suite, a king-size double with an en-suite and a final ground floor twin room. There is also a ground floor bathroom and an open plan living area with a kitchen, dining area and a sitting area with a woodburner. Outside is off road parking for two cars, a lawned garden with a patio and furniture and a hot tub. The Barn is ideal for a large family or couples to get away from it all and relax.

Accommodation Details

Three bedrooms: 1 x super king-size double with en-suite shower, basin and WC, 1 x king-size double with en-suite shower, basin and WC, 1 x ground floor twin. Ground floor bathroom with bath, shower over, basin and WC. Open plan living area with kitchen, dining area and sitting area with woodburner.

A fabulous, terraced barn conversion on the owner’s working farm in the pretty hamlet of Milton, just a short drive from Brampton. Lovingly converted, the interior of The Barn has been well-thought-out to provide maximum comfort for guests. The sitting room has a warming woodburner and sumptuous sofas, the large windows overlook the enclosed garden and French doors lead to the patio area. This is an ideal spot for letting the dogs safely stretch their legs or just relaxing and watching the sun descend behind the Tindle Fells to the West. On frosty evenings what would be better than battening down the hatches, and relaxing in front of the woodburner whilst watching a film on the 50" Smart TV! The adjoining kitchen/diner has a large table, ideal for those family meals or a spot of Monopoly. The Barn is ideal for a large family or couples, with two en-suite bedrooms and a family bathroom for the third bedroom. Perfectly positioned for visiting the Scottish Borders, Northern Lakes and Pennines, this is a wonderful place for a Cumbrian break at any time of year. Note: This cottage is next to Refs. 3738, 3739, 4585, 917515, 922499 and 941220, 949797, together they sleep 30.

Ideally placed for exploring northern Cumbria, the hamlet of Milton is close to all of the region's most popular attractions including Hadrians Wall, the Solway Firth coast and the Lake District National Park. The nearby market town of Brampton dates back to the Roman occupation, and shows evidence of attacks from Scottish border raiders and Jacobite uprisings.

Amenities & Facilities

Electric wall heaters with woodburner. Electric oven and hob, microwave, fridge/freezer, washing machine, dishwasher, Smart TV with Freeview and Netflix, DVD, CD/radio, WiFi, selection of books and DVDs. Fuel, power and starter pack for woodburner inc. in rent. Bed linen and towels inc. in rent. Cot, highchair and stairgate on request. Off road parking for 2 cars. Lockable bike storage. Enclosed lawned garden with patio and furniture. Sole use of hot tub all year round. Two well-behaved dogs welcome. Sorry, no smoking. Shop and pub 2 miles. Note: There are 3 steps to access property at front.

Owner was helpful from time of booking all the way through to when we left. The property itself was very spacious. Master bedroom overlooks fields with sheep and their barn. Dont be surprised to hear them. As visit was in March plenty of lambs on view. Both upstairs bedrooms have spacious bathrooms which have showers. If you want a bath then use downstairs bathroom. Water pressure was not great but not the worst. Parking is ok outside so long as everyone parks sensibly. For me it was good as it meant I could park right by the front door and my disabled mother in law did not have to walk far. Kitchen was well supplied with lots of mugs, glasses, plates, pots, serving dishes etc. Decent size fridge freezer. If blinds are open then yes passers by can see into the kitchen. The passers by are normally the farm workers in their vehicles. They are not going by past every 5 minutes so was t an issue. My biggest bug bear of the entire week has to be the smoke alarm! Would go off every time you used the toaster. When I cooked with the hob or oven no issues just that toaster. We even moved the toaster! Living room was an ok size with seating for 6. The internet was of a decent speed. Husband liked the tv as it was modern and large. The garden is quite spacious with a lawn. In a couple of years garden will look prettier once the trees have grown. Patio space is ok but be careful as a few of the slabs are not secured. Hot tub was nice and large. It had a feature I’ve never seen before with a metal bar that makes taking the cover off and on so much easier. Due to the weather being very windy we only got to use the wood burner a couple of times :-(. Also due to the weather discovered quite a few drafts but the radiators in each of the rooms helped. I have already recommended this place to a friend. Definitely on my list to check out on future stays when visiting family.

The weathe was bitterly cold but sunny interspersed with hailstones but thanks to the warmth and comfort of the barn we had a great week. Every comfort was there, good settees, good tv, super beds, good cooker, excellent bathroom facilitiesa and a helpful farmer`s wife who had information if you wanted to take it. Yes, the kitchen alarm went off once but we had burnt toast! and when the farm was busy we just half-closed the long blinds in the kitchen to make it more private and to stop our dogs having a bark, but the room was still bright and pleasant. Parking was outside the door in the farmyard and at first when you drive in it looks a little off putting because everyone else is parking outside their cottages too. Maybe in the busy summer period this could be a problem but we found it ok. the enclosed garden was excellent , safe for dogs and children and pleasant to have a coffee outside. The hot-tub wasn`t our cup of tea so we just ignored it. We hope to return later this year.
